1. Who: Albert Bandura was a man that received various awards for his many accomplishments. He is known around the world for many things. He was born in 1925 and attended two universities. The two universities that he attended were British Columbia and the University of Iowa. He there received his bachelors degree and his Ph.D. While attending Iowa, Bandura met Virgina Varns. Virgina was an instructor in the nursing school at Iowa. They later had married and they eventually had two beautiful daughters. After Bandura graduated he took a postdoctoral position at the Wichita guidance center in Kansas. Then in 1953 he then started teaching at Stanford. The modeling theory is applied in many classrooms today. An example of how this is applied from student to student is if a student sees another student jumping up and down and acting hyper then a student may come over to the student and jump up and down and act the same goofy way. An example for the teacher/student role to re-enact the modeling theory is if a student sees the teacher acting impatient and or mean then the student might act the same way and model the behavior of the teacher.
